UK-based premium steel manufacturer British Steel has announced that it has signed a share purchase agreement for the acquisition of the Netherlands-based premium wire rod manufacturer FNsteel.
British Steel’s CEO Peter Bernscher stated that the acquisition would complement British Steel’s current capabilities as FNsteel makes different specifications of wire rod to those it manufactures in its Scunthorpe site in the UK, therefore enabling it to improve and enhance its value chain and customer offering.
FNsteel employs nearly 300 people at its wire rod mill in Alblasserdam and has an annual turnover of £133 million. The company manufactures wire rod in a diameter range of 5.5-30 mm and is a respected supplier of highly specialized products to the European automotive, construction and engineering industries.
